How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rainsville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rainsville Studio Apartments | $1,450 | $1,450 | $1,450 |
| Rainsville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,149 | $525 | $2,196 |
| Rainsville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,320 | $555 | $3,064 |
| Rainsville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,499 | $671 | $3,716 |
| Rainsville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,699 | $1,479 | $1,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Rainsville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Rainsville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Rainsville is $1,072.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Rainsville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Rainsville is a 1,150 square feet unit starting from $899 at Summer Place.
What is the average size for Rainsville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Rainsville is currently at 850 sq ft.
